Titan Energy Systems Inc. Signs Distributor Agreement with Generac Power Systems

FORT LEE, N.J. – Titan Energy Systems Inc., a subsidiary of Pioneer Power Solutions, Inc. (Nasdaq: PPSI), a company engaged in the manufacture, sale and service of electrical transmission, distribution and on-site power generation equipment, recently signed an agreement with Generac Power Systems to exclusively represent Generac Industrial Power throughout Minnesota, Nebraska and Iowa. Titan Energy Systems Inc. is now one of only 30 such distributors throughout North America.

“We are very pleased by Generac’s show of support in renewing and extending its distributor relationship with Titan, a company we acquired just last month,” commented Nathan Mazurek, Pioneer’s chief executive officer.  “We are committed to accelerating Titan’s business, in particular by capitalizing on Generac’s recently expanded line of large kw gensets to drive sales of complex, paralleled systems for mission critical facilities – an area where Pioneer has an extensive track record.”

Mr. Mazurek continued, “To help propel this effort, I am also pleased to announce the appointment of Kindra Davis as General Manager of Titan Energy Systems Inc. Kindra will bring to bear her 12 years of power generation experience at Cummins Power Generation, where she served most recently as a territory business development manager. Kindra will report to George Moothedan, head of Pioneer’s Critical Power division, to ensure full alignment in the execution of our strategic goals.”

Generac Power Systems, a market leader in standby generators for commercial and industrial applications, continues to invest in the development of its network of industrial product distributors in support of the company’s expansion of products into industrial power applications up to 100 megawatts and to grant customers access to Generac’s full breadth of product.

As a Generac Industrial Power distributor, Titan Energy Systems Inc. will work with engineers, facility managers, and electrical contractors to specify Generac products in a number of industries and applications, such as data centers, healthcare facilities, retail outlets, and more.

“We’ve worked with Titan for many years, and during 2014 began building a relationship with Pioneer as supplier of paralleling switchgear to our network of industrial distributors,” said Kyle Raabe, vice president of industrial dealer sales at Generac.  “We are very excited that Titan has signed on with us in this new and expanded role, and by extension would also like to welcome Pioneer to the Generac family. We look forward to working with them as they grow their business and continue providing outstanding sales and service support to existing and prospective customers.”
